Re: stage libgcc multilibs as well


On Apr 12, 2003, Andreas Jaeger <aj at suse dot de> wrote:

> Alexandre Oliva <aoliva at redhat dot com> writes:
>> Just like crt* files, that I've arranged to have staged for all
>> multilibs in a previous patch, libgcc must be staged as well.

> Isn't this also needed for 3.3?

Well, I suppose it could go into 3.3 as well, even though the only
port that actually needs this feature for proper bootstrap (with
default options) is mips64-linux-gnu, that is new in 3.4.  If anyone
has a good reason for it to be in 3.3, I'm all for it.
